1980 Ferrari 308 vs. 2005 Ford Escape

To start off, 2005 Ford Escape is newer by 25 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Ferrari 308.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Ferrari 308 would be higher. At 2,927 cc (8 cylinders), 1980 Ferrari 308 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1980 Ferrari 308 (240 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 112 more horse power than 2005 Ford Escape. (128 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1980 Ferrari 308 should accelerate faster than 2005 Ford Escape.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Ford Escape weights approximately 361 kg more than 1980 Ferrari 308.

Because 1980 Ferrari 308 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1980 Ferrari 308.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Ford Escape,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1980 Ferrari 308 (260 Nm) has 92 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Ford Escape. (168 Nm). This means 1980 Ferrari 308 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Ford Escape.

Compare all specifications:

1980 Ferrari 308 2005 Ford Escape
Make Ferrari Ford
Model 308 Escape
Year Released 1980 2005
Body Type Convertible SUV
Engine Position Middle Front
Engine Size 2927 cc 2262 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 240 HP 128 HP
Engine RPM 7000 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 260 Nm 168 Nm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.2:1 12.3: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line / Electric Hybrid
Drive Type Rear Front
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1284 kg 1645 kg
Vehicle Length 4240 mm 4450 mm
Vehicle Width 1730 mm 1790 mm
Vehicle Height 1130 mm 1790 mm
Wheelbase Size 2350 mm 2620 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 74 L 57 L
